[docs]def instanciates_app(mission=None): """defines all the routes and others parameters for the app """ app = Bottle() error_api = ErrorApiBottle() if mission is None: mission_api = MissionApiBottle(Mission()) else: mission_api = MissionApiBottle(mission) dive_api = DiveApiBottle(mission_api.mission) tank_api = TankApiBottle(mission_api.mission) input_segment_api = InputSegmentApiBottle(mission_api.mission) output_segment_api = OutputSegmentApiBottle(mission_api.mission) # Mission app.route(ROOT_API_URL + 'mission/', method='GET')(mission_api.get) app.route(ROOT_API_URL + 'mission/status', method='GET')(mission_api.get_status) app.route(ROOT_API_URL + 'mission/calculate', method='POST')(mission_api.calculate) app.route(ROOT_API_URL + 'mission/', method='POST')(mission_api.post) app.route(ROOT_API_URL + 'mission/', method='PATCH')(mission_api.patch) app.route(ROOT_API_URL + 'mission/', method='DELETE')(mission_api.delete) # dives app.route(ROOT_API_URL + 'mission/dives/', method='GET')(dive_api.get) app.route(ROOT_API_URL + 'mission/dives/<resource_id>', method='GET')(dive_api.get) app.route(ROOT_API_URL + 'mission/dives/', method='POST')(dive_api.post) app.route(ROOT_API_URL + 'mission/dives/<resource_id>', method='PATCH')(dive_api.patch) app.route(ROOT_API_URL + 'mission/dives/', method='DELETE')(dive_api.delete) app.route(ROOT_API_URL + 'mission/dives/<resource_id>', method='DELETE')(dive_api.delete) # tanks app.route(ROOT_API_URL + 'mission/tanks/', method='GET')(tank_api.get) app.route(ROOT_API_URL + 'mission/tanks/<tank_id>', method='GET')(tank_api.get) app.route(ROOT_API_URL + 'mission/tanks/', method='POST')(tank_api.post) app.route(ROOT_API_URL + 'mission/tanks/<tank_id>', method='PATCH')(tank_api.patch) app.route(ROOT_API_URL + 'mission/tanks/', method='DELETE')(tank_api.delete) app.route(ROOT_API_URL + 'mission/tanks/<tank_id>', method='DELETE')(tank_api.delete) # input_segments app.route(ROOT_API_URL + 'mission/dives/<dive_id>/input_segments/', method='GET')(input_segment_api.get) app.route(ROOT_API_URL + 'mission/dives/<dive_id>/input_segments/<segment_id>', method='GET')(input_segment_api.get) app.route(ROOT_API_URL + 'mission/dives/<dive_id>/input_segments/', method='POST')(input_segment_api.post) app.route(ROOT_API_URL + 'mission/dives/<dive_id>/input_segments/<segment_id>', method='PATCH')(input_segment_api.patch) app.route(ROOT_API_URL + 'mission/dives/<dive_id>/input_segments/', method='DELETE')(input_segment_api.delete) app.route(ROOT_API_URL + 'mission/dives/<dive_id>/input_segments/<segment_id>', method='DELETE')(input_segment_api.delete) # output_segments app.route(ROOT_API_URL + 'mission/dives/<dive_id>/output_segments/', method='GET')(output_segment_api.get) app.route(ROOT_API_URL + 'mission/dives/<dive_id>/output_segments/<segment_id>', method='GET')(output_segment_api.get) # custom error handling app.error(404)(error_api.error404) app.error(405)(error_api.error405) return app
[docs]def start_gui(mission=None, http_host='locahost', http_port=8080): """Starts the html GUI server """ print("Starting Gui on %s:%s" % (http_host, http_port)) #global server #server = MyWSGIRefServer(host=http_host, port=http_port) app = instanciates_app(mission) debug(True) run(app, host=http_host, port=http_port)
